Common Carrier HVAC Problems We Solve in West Athens
- Infinity series condenser fan motor failures from voltage surges. West Athens homes built in the 1950s and 1960s commonly still run 100-amp panels with degraded bus bars. When that aging infrastructure delivers inconsistent voltage, Infinity series variable-speed motors, which are precisely tuned for steady power, burn out prematurely. We replaced one on a 95°F July afternoon at a bungalow on West 109th Street, upgrading the panel feed to 8-gauge wire to handle the startup load.
- Performance series heat exchanger cracks from attic cycling stress. These units often get retrofitted into uninsulated West Athens attics where summer temperatures exceed 130°F. Years of expansion and contraction against gas wall heater remnants, combined with poor attic ventilation in those tight postwar rooflines, stress the heat exchanger welds.
- Comfort series capacitor failures accelerated by inland heat waves. West Athens sits 8–10 miles inland, losing the marine layer that cools Hawthorne and Gardena. When temperatures spike into the low-to-mid 90s, Comfort series single-stage compressors draw harder on their run capacitors, which degrade faster than in true coastal zones. We stock 35/5 and 45/5 MFD dual capacitors for same-day replacement.
- Evaporator coil leaks from formicary corrosion. Coastal air reaches West Athens more than fully inland communities, carrying just enough salt and organic acid to attack the copper tubing in older Carrier coils. We’ve found this on 10-15 year old Comfort series air handlers more often here than in San Diego’s drier eastern suburbs.
- Control board communication errors in Infinity systems. The Infinity series relies on a proprietary communicating thermostat and board protocol. When homeowners in West Athens upgrade electrical panels or add whole-house surge protection without proper grounding, the low-voltage communication bus picks up interference. We trace the signal path with Carrier-specific diagnostic tools, not generic multimeters.
Carrier Service in West Athens: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ment
West Athens is unincorporated Los Angeles County, not an incorporated city. That jurisdictional fact shapes every Carrier installation we do here. All HVAC permits run through LA County’s Department of Public Works Building & Safety online portal, and inspections are scheduled through county inspectors, not city code officials. Contractors accustomed to Carrier repair in Gardena‘s streamlined city process or Inglewood’s local building department often submit incomplete Title 24 energy compliance documentation on their first county job, delaying inspection by weeks.
We’ve pulled enough county permits to know the exact workflow. For a Carrier Performance series 16 SEER heat pump retrofit on a 1950s bungalow, we submit the MECH-1 application, Title 24 CF-1R compliance forms, and load calculations showing how the new air handler integrates with existing or new ductwork. The county inspector checks refrigerant line insulation, condensate drainage to approved disposal, and electrical disconnect placement per county amendments. The most common cause in West Athens is voltage instability from aging 100-amp panels or loose connections in the disconnect box. Infinity variable-speed motors draw precise current, and even brief undervoltage causes the motor to pull harder, tripping the breaker. We’ve also seen this from failed condenser fan motors drawing locked-rotor amps. We test with Carrier-specific diagnostic tools to distinguish between motor failure and electrical supply issues.
